PileGroup Tutorial Examples

In this tutorial example, the use of the PileGroup program is demonstrated for analysing a pile group in clay, including battered piles. The example covers the overall workflow—from creating the pile group model to defining soil conditions, applying loads to the pile cap, and reviewing the analysis results.

In this tutorial example, the use of the PileGroup program is demonstrated for analysing a pile group in sand. This example involves a 4 x 4 pile group consisting of 16 numbers of 760 mm diameter driven prestressed concrete piles of 16.5 m long, which were spaced at three pile diameters in both directions.

In this tutorial example, the use of the PileGroup program is demonstrated for analysing a pile group subject to TBM launching loading. This example involves a pile group consisting of 20 numbers of 1200 mm diameter CFA piles of 20 m long, which were spaced at three pile diameters in both directions.
